I know what you're saying, a LOT of people are actually doing a good bit over the speed limit. I don't even see a problem with everybody doing 90, as long as pretty much everybody is doing it. The problem comes with the speed differential. Even if everybody is doing 90, when you're blasting down the highway at 150, that's a 60 mph differential....pretty much the same thing as hitting a parked car while travelling at 60 mph.

so, Hedonist and GaryK....would you go complain everywhere if you lived in germany and someone flew by you on the autobahn going super fast? cause, i know many people that have driven far above 150 on the autobanh. are they bad people? it's not against the law...so, they are free to do whatever they want.
I've lived in Germany, and driven on the autobahn at high speeds before, so I know what the culture is like. For one, driving is a privilege there, and an expensive one at that. Plus there is a driving etiquette not found anywhere in the U.S., and the roads are designed for those speeds (most U.S. roads are not). European headlights are much brighter as well and are designed to show the road differently. Don't forget that most of the autobahn has a speed limit now, so there aren't as many avenues for unlimited speed. You also don't see people weaving at 150mph.

I in no way criticized the speed limit here, in fact, I know it's too slow. However, driving like that on a public highway is ridiculous, especially when our little stunnarific friend posts on a public board bragging how he weaved in and out of traffic at 150mph with other cars to evade the police.
